Overview Femiclot M 500mg/250mg Tablet

Menstrual pain and heavy bleeding are effectively managed with the combined medication, Ciclofem 500mg/250mg tablets. This medication works by inhibiting clot breakdown, thereby reducing excessive menstrual flow, and simultaneously suppressing pain-inducing and inflammatory chemical signals. Ciclofem 500mg/250mg tablets can be ingested with food at any time of day, ideally at a consistent time daily. For optimal results, commence treatment on the first day of menstruation and continue as directed by your physician. Missed doses should be taken immediately upon recollection. Complete the prescribed course, even if symptoms improve. Report any lack of menstrual change after three consecutive cycles to your doctor. Common adverse effects include nausea, abdominal discomfort, headache, nasal stuffiness, sinusitis, skin rashes, fatigue, and musculoskeletal pain. Diarrhea is also possible; increased fluid intake is recommended to prevent dehydration. Consult your physician if no menstrual changes are observed after three cycles. Prior to starting treatment, disclose any kidney issues, vaginal bleeding disorders, pregnancy, or breastfeeding to your physician. List all other current medications. Regular eye examinations may be required during treatment. Alcohol consumption should be avoided while using this medication.

How Femiclot M 500mg/250mg Tablet works:

Femiclot M 500mg/250mg tablets contain Tranexamic Acid and Mefenamic Acid, working synergistically to manage menstrual bleeding and associated discomfort. Tranexamic Acid stabilizes blood clots, reducing heavy menstrual flow. Mefenamic Acid, an NSAID, inhibits prostaglandin synthesis, thereby alleviating pain and inflammation characteristic of menstruation.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ol while taking Femiclot M 500mg/250mg Tablets is inadvisable.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Femiclot M 500mg/250m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to a fetus. A physician will assess the potential advantages against the risks before recommending this medication. It is essential to se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The use of Femiclot M 500mg/250mg tablets while breastfeeding is likely safe. Available human data indicates minimal ris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king Femiclot M 500mg/250mg tablets might reduce awareness, impair vision, or cause drowsiness and d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these effects.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with kidney impairment should use Femiclot M 500mg/250mg T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Consult a physician for guidance. Femiclot M 500mg/250mg Tablets are contraindicated in individuals with severe kidney disease.

LiverLi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The use of Femiclot M 500mg/250mg tablets in individuals with hepatic impairment is likely safe. Preliminary evidence indicates dose modification may be unnecessary, however, physician consultation is recommended.

What if you forget to take Femiclot M 500mg/250mg Tablet :

Should you forget a dose of Femiclot M 500mg/250mg Tablet, administer it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Femiclot M 500mg/250mg Tablet

Femiclot M 500mg/250mg tablets combine tranexamic acid and mefenamic acid to relieve menstrual pain and heavy bleeding in women.
Patients with severe kidney failure, active intravascular clotting, or color vision disorders should avoid it, as it's harmful to them.
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container, following the storage instructions on the label. Discard any unused medication and keep it out of reach of children, pets, and others.
